What they do

A Healthcare Administrator directs and coordinates delivery of health care and medical services. Manages finances and recordkeeping and communications with medical staff. Works to improve quality and efficiency. May run smaller medical practices or work in specialized areas within large hospitals or health care systems.

Memory Care Partners Management, LLC is hiring for an Administrator for our new facility, Weston Memory Care Community Based Residential Facility in Weston, WI. We specialize in Alzheimer's and Dementia care and are seeking to hire an Administrator to join our management team. The Administrator position is a salaried manager and will require on-call participation with the entire management team. We'd love to have you join our team. The Administrator is responsible for leading and directing the overall operations of the facility in accordance with resident needs, government regulations and MCP policies, with focus on maintaining excellent care for the residents while achieving the facility's business objectives. The Administrator is responsible for the overall facility management, profitability, operations, and direction in all aspects.
Administrator assists with:
Involvement and opening of new facility including marketing, training, and preparing to care for the elderly population Census development State and federal survey compliance Positive employee relations, and other internal Human Resource functions Following all MCP policies and procedures Completing rounds of entire facility premises at least daily to ensure compliance with all policies, procedures, and regulations. Being a key and visible supervisor working directly with all residents, family, and employees. The timely oversight of the accounting systems within the facility and those which interface with the home office and timely collection of accounts receivable from all payer sources The maintenance of accurate and complete trust account records, census information, billing and resident accounts receivable statements, wages paid to employees' payroll and make deposits Administrator's essential functions include but not limited to: Proven leadership skills inside and outside of the facility Supervision Responsibilities Accounts Receivable Compliance Net Operating Income Labor and Workforce Planning The Administrator shall possess any one of the following qualifications: Shall be at least 21 years of age and exhibit the capacity to respond to the needs of the residents and manage the complexity of the CBRF. An associate degree or higher from an accredited college in a health care related field A bachelor's degree in a field other than in health care from an accredited college and one year experience working in a healthcare related field having direct contact with one or more of the client groups identified under s.
DHS 83.02
(16). A bachelor's degree in a field other than in health care from an accredited college and have successfully completed an assisted living administrator's training course approved by the department or the department's designee. At least 2 years experience working in a healthcare related field having direct contact with one or more of the client groups identified under s.
DHS 83.02
(16) and have successfully completed an assisted living administrator's training course approved by the department or the department's designee.
